Katunayake Airport to City Transfers

Bandaranaike International Airport sits in Katunayake, roughly 35 kilometres north of central Colombo. That distance sounds modest on a map, but depending on the time of day, traffic on the A3 highway can stretch the ride to well over an hour. Knowing your transfer options before you land makes the difference between a smooth arrival and an exhausting one.

What transfer options are available from Katunayake Airport to Colombo?

Travellers leaving the arrivals hall have several ways to reach Colombo or neighbouring cities:

  • Private chauffeur transfer — a pre-booked, air-conditioned car or van meets you in the arrivals hall by name board. This is the most reliable choice for families, groups, or travellers with heavy luggage.
  • Metered taxi — airport-approved metered taxis are available at the official rank just outside arrivals. Agree on the meter or a fixed fare before you depart.
  • Rideshare apps — PickMe and Uber both operate at the airport, though surge pricing during peak hours is common.
  • Airport Express train — the Katunayake Expressway rail link connects the airport to Colombo Fort station. Journey time is around 30–40 minutes, making it one of the fastest options when the road is congested.
  • Shuttle buses — some hotels and transit properties near the airport offer complimentary or low-cost shuttles for their guests.

For travellers continuing directly to Negombo, the coastal town is only around 8 kilometres from the airport — a journey of 20 minutes or less under normal conditions.

How long does the drive from Katunayake Airport to Colombo city take?

Under clear conditions, the journey on the Colombo–Katunayake Expressway (E03) takes around 30–40 minutes to reach central Colombo. During morning and evening rush hours — typically 7–9 am and 4–7 pm — congestion on the expressway approach roads can add another 30–60 minutes. Early-morning arrivals and late-night flights tend to move fastest. If your flight lands between 5 am and 7 am, or after 9 pm, budget around 40 minutes to most Colombo hotels.

Should I pre-book my airport transfer in Sri Lanka?

Pre-booking is strongly advisable, particularly for international arrivals on late-night or early-morning flights when taxi availability at the rank can be limited. A confirmed reservation also means a fixed fare — you will not face negotiation after a long-haul flight. What vehicle types are available for airport transfers?

The right vehicle depends on group size and luggage volume:

Vehicle typeTypical capacityBest suited for
Sedan (Toyota Prius or similar)1–3 passengersSolo travellers, couples
SUV / Crossover1–4 passengersSmall families, extra luggage
Minivan (Toyota KDH)Up to 8 passengersGroups, families with children
Coach / Minibus10+ passengersLarge groups, corporate transfers

How do I get from the airport to destinations beyond Colombo?

Many visitors use their airport transfer as the first leg of a longer itinerary. Common onward routes from Katunayake include:

  • Airport to Kandy — roughly 120 kilometres, typically 3–4 hours by road depending on traffic through Colombo.
  • Airport to Negombo — under 10 kilometres; a natural first-night stop before heading south or into the Cultural Triangle.
  • Airport to Sigiriya / Dambulla — around 180 kilometres, 3.5–4.5 hours via the expressway and A9 highway.
  • Airport to Galle — approximately 130 kilometres south, around 2 hours on the Southern Expressway once you clear Colombo.

Is there accommodation near Katunayake Airport for transit passengers?

Several transit hotels and villa properties sit within a short drive of the terminal — useful if you have an early-morning departure or a long layover. Properties in the Katunayake area typically offer room-only rates, airport shuttle services, and 24-hour reception. Negombo, just a few kilometres further, adds beach access and a wider choice of restaurants and guesthouses to the mix.

What should I know about arriving at Bandaranaike International Airport?

The airport has a single integrated passenger terminal. On clearing immigration and customs, you will enter the arrivals hall, where you will find currency exchange counters, ATMs, a tourist board information desk, and a metered taxi rank. Mobile data SIM cards are sold by all major Sri Lankan operators at counters just past customs — picking one up before your transfer saves time and keeps you connected if plans change en route.
